Facts

Teri Marcellino and her three children sue Derrick Cunningham Trucking Inc. and Mark Sparks for motor vehicle negligence in the wrongful death of decedent John Marcellino.

Contentions

PLAINTIFF'S CONTENTIONS:
The plaintiffs alleged that Sparks acted in the course and scope of his employment with Derrick Cunningham when he negligently operated his tractor trailer, which collided with the decedent's vehicle and killed him.

Settlement Discussions

The plaintiffs demanded $1 million and the defense offered $50,000.

Damages

The plaintiffs requested $900,000 in economic damages and $2 million in non-economic damages.

Injuries

The plaintiffs claimed death.

Result

The jury found in favor of the defense.
